Optoma UHC70LV Projector Reviewed

Premium Home Entertainment, Redefined

Optoma UHC70LV
Optoma UHC70LV Projector

Optoma, a leading name in high-end projectors, continues its winning streak with the UHC70LV. Priced around ₹7,50,000, this is a true flagship for home cinema enthusiasts who crave the ultimate big-screen experience.

Key Features

  • Projection Size: Easily up to 120 inches, perfect for immersive movie nights or live sports
  • Resolution & Display Tech: Native 4K, with Dolby Vision and HDR10+ support for rich, vibrant imagery
  • Filmmaker Mode: A dedicated setting for authentic cinematic experiences
  • PureEngine Ultra Suite: Optoma’s proprietary algorithms—PureColor, PureContrast, PureLight, PureMotion, and PureDetail—offer extensive picture refinement and manual tweaking
  • Brightness: A robust 5000 lumens DuraCore laser lamp ensures clarity in any lighting

User Experience: Pros and Cons

The UHC70LV is engineered to impress, delivering exceptional image quality in everyday living rooms—regardless of ambient light. During real-world testing (with F1 races, movies, cricket, and even YouTube content), the projector stood out for:

  • Stellar image processing—colors pop, and motion remains smooth even during fast-paced action
  • Customizable display settings—whether you love vivid sports or cinematic film warmth, fine-tuning is easy

However, no product is perfect. The main drawbacks include:

  • Audio limitations: The onboard speakers lack power and depth; consider an external soundbar or surround sound setup
  • No built-in smart TV interface: There’s no Google TV or Android, which—for many—may be a plus, as dedicated streaming devices like Apple TV 4K deliver a smoother experience anyway
  • Remote needs improvement: Sometimes requires a second press for commands to register

Who Should Buy the Optoma UHC70LV?

  • Serious home theater fans seeking true 4K quality
  • Anyone wanting cinematic visuals without compromise
  • Those prepared to invest in a separate sound system for a complete big-screen experience

Bottom Line: As large-screen TVs break new boundaries, high-end projectors like the UHC70LV are legitimate, if not superior, alternatives for turning your living room into a cinema.


AI’s Struggle with Reliability: Microsoft Copilot in Excel

Microsoft Copilot
Microsoft Copilot

Artificial Intelligence is increasingly woven into everyday productivity software, but recent news highlights the limitations of relying solely on AI for critical tasks.

What Happened?

  • Microsoft integrated its OpenAI-powered Copilot assistant into Excel to automate formulas, categorize data, and summarize ranges—tempting enterprises with visions of full automation.
  • However, Microsoft’s own support documentation explicitly warns users: Copilot can give incorrect responses and recommends continuing to use native Excel formulas for tasks requiring accuracy and reproducibility.

Why Is This a Big Deal?

  • AI “accuracy” is not guaranteed. Even major tech companies admit their tools may “hallucinate.”
  • Human oversight is essential, particularly for business-critical data work—in other words: double-check, don’t just trust the bot!
  • This honest disclaimer from Microsoft exposes a wider challenge: AI tools are useful (and exciting), but not infallible.

So, if you’re using Copilot, ChatGPT, or any AI-powered tool in your workflow, use their suggestions as a starting point, not a final word.


Duracell’s “Bitter Coating”: Battery Safety Gets Smarter

Lithium Coin Batteries
Duracell Lithium Coin Batteries with Bitter Coating

A Simple Solution to a Complex Safety Problem

Household lithium coin batteries are tiny, powerful—and potentially dangerous if swallowed by small children. With devices like Apple AirTags, remote controls, and toys all using these batteries, accidental ingestion cases have risen globally.

Duracell’s answer: a non-toxic “Bitter Coating” now added to the most commonly used battery sizes (CR2025, CR2016, and CR2032).

How Does It Work?

  • The battery surface releases a very bitter taste when it contacts saliva, strongly deterring children from swallowing it.
  • Packaging is clearly labeled to inform parents and caregivers.

Why It Matters

  • Child safety: Swallowing button batteries can cause serious internal injuries
  • Passive protection: This feature adds a crucial layer of defense, especially with so many battery-powered devices in homes

Upcoming Apple Store Openings in India

  • Apple is set to open two new stores:
    • Apple Hebbal, Bengaluru (Sept 2)
    • Apple Koregaon Park, Pune (Sept 4)

    These join existing locations in Delhi and Mumbai.

  • Why the timing?
    • Apple’s iPhone 17 launch is scheduled for September 9; retail expansion ensures more buyers can get hands-on support and direct access.
    • Apple is reinforcing its India strategy—balancing online and premium offline experiences, and preparing for growing domestic manufacturing.
    • Expanding retail ensures higher engagement and revenue from both local buyers and export units produced in India.
